Perovskite solar cells

  • Solar cells that can be installed even in places where conventional models would be unacceptable, such as on the windows of buildings, and are thus harmonious with community and daily life
  • Achievement of the world’s highest-level 18.1% energy conversion efficiency for a perovskite solar cell module
  • Large cells that provide flexibility in size with high energy conversion efficiency due to the adoption of unique inkjet coating technology and materials technology

Green hydrogen manufacturing device

  • Development of Panasonic’s unique nonprecious-metal highly active anode material (NiFe-LDH)
  • Hydrogen manufacturing efficiency (of 74.7%@1A/cm2 on a laboratory level) proven with anion exchange membrane water electrolysis
  • Development under way for the application of this material technology for an anode material for alkaline water electrolysis

All-solid-state battery

  • Battery that outstrips conventional lithium-ion secondary batteries in terms of output, brevity of charging time, and safety and security
  • Unique solid electrolyte developed by Panasonic by using halide with high ionic conductivity
  • Development of a high-speed ionic conductivity evaluation method by taking a computational science-based approach for automatic diffusion path search

Bio CO2 Transformation technology to accelerate the growth of plants

  • Application of unique microbial technology for the effective use of atmospheric CO2, which can be procured in unlimited quantities, to realize economically rational production of commercial products
  • Activation of energy metabolism through photosynthesis-based cell metabolism to increase yield, stabilize production and enhance immunity
  • Simple spraying onto leaves and no need to make substantial changes to or large capital investments in conventional agricultural work
We recover plant growth stimulants from photosynthetic microorganisms modified by our proprietary technology. Spraying this liquid, branded as Novitek, on the leaves of crops can increase the yield by up to 40%.

Automating the recycling of home electrical appliances for a circular economy

  • Identification and removal of screws even where there is rust or stains
  • Careful disassembly of the cover of an outdoor unit by a robot imitating the movements of an experienced worker
  • Efficient operation by building a database of the numbers and locations of screws used in various outdoor units

Plant-derived sustainable material: Cellulose-based material

  • Lighter and stronger than conventional petroleum-based resin due to the use of cellulose
  • Performance on par with that of conventional petroleum-based resin
  • Usability of a conventional petroleum-based resin molding machine
  • Development under way to make the resin, including binder resin used in it, 100% biodegradable
